Swisscubing Mental Breakdown 2018

Ecublens · 6 January 2018 · 5 events · 15 competitors · 7 personal bests

Oleg Gritsenko won two of the five events (4×4 blindfolded, 3×3 Multi-Blind). 15 competitors produced 7 personal bests.

The moment

A national record

Tobias Peter set the 5×5 blindfolded single national record: 19:25.00.

Two wins
Oleg Gritsenko — 4×4 blindfolded, 3×3 Multi-Blind

    Reading this page: a single is one solve's time · an average is the middle three of five solves, best and worst discarded · a PB is a personal best · a final is a competition's last round; its order decides the podium · a DNF (did not finish) is an attempt with no valid result: a popped piece, an unsolved face, an over-limit memorisation · every solve starts from a computer-generated scramble, the same for every competitor in a round.
